What is the cheapest month to fly from Montreal Pierre Elliott Trudeau Intl Airport to Arizona?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Montreal Pierre Elliott Trudeau Intl Airport to Arizona,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Montreal Pierre Elliott Trudeau Intl Airport to Arizona is August, when tickets cost C$ 143 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are September and May, when the average cost of round-trip tickets is C$ 331 and C$ 321 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Montreal Pierre Elliott Trudeau Intl Airport to Arizona?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Montreal Pierre Elliott Trudeau Intl Airport to Arizona,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below-average price on a flight from Montreal Pierre Elliott Trudeau Intl Airport to Arizona,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 48%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 6 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Montreal to Arizona?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ly from Montreal to Arizona with an airline and back with another airline.
